Starting off with the ceremony. Little Turtle has a wonderful outside patio that is perfect for ceremonies. Its super convenient since its RIGHT next to the main room. But at the same time, its somewhat hidden and private with trees and bushes.
When you combine that location with the beautiful fall weather its going to be great start to their life together. We supplied the music and microphones for the ceremony. The pictures just don’t do it justice, but we got some great pictures!
Cookie table was one of the most impressive we’ve ever seen. It was all I could do to not eat them all before the guests arrived. It was tough, but I held out. We are starting to see more and more of these cookie tables at our reception. They do draw a crowd, but guests are never quite sure when they are allowed to start helping themselves.
Backdrop. They had a really nice backdrop behind the sweetheart table. It wasn’t anything fancy - just a simply hanging drape. Bu when they added their names, it just looked great. The sun shining thru made it look like the backdrop was lit.
